20 long miles this morning. I'm still pretty tired from traveling (early flights, etc.) so I slept until 6:45 and left the house by 7:30, both really late for me. It worked out fine. Temps were perfect, 45F and overcast skies with hardly a wind. Shorts, long-sleeve shirt, and gloves weather. More wind would've meant a hat but no wind today, which was fantastic. Headed up my normal Saturday set of hills. My body was definitely tired from the week and yesterday's 3 fast miles, so I took it slower than I have been, but I woke up at mile 3.5 which is in the middle of my hill. I like the challenge of hills. They make me happy. The plan today was to do 15 miles then go home and meet my wife as she wanted to do 5 with me on a route she's never done. I was feeling pretty rough by 15 but after taking a 10 minute break at home I felt refreshed. Changed my shoes, shirt, gloves, bandanna, and replaced my Nathan backpack for a water belt. We ran slowly down the hill from our house, which is 1.5 miles, then Kaylene had to head back home so we parted ways. I ran up a killer hill I've only done a couple times before. It is a brutal 600 foot climb over 1.25 miles that has a solid mile with zero flat spots. It was a great workout, especially after 16 miles. The rest of the way home is pretty tough on this route, which is why I don't normally do it, but it felt good to be hurting a bit after a long morning of running. Good training.

AP: 8:56. Good run.
